Patents by Inventor Klaus D. Maier

Klaus D. Maier has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7222263
    Abstract: A program-controlled unit includes a core for executing the program to be executed by the program-controlled unit, and debug resources for tracking and influencing the operations proceeding within the core. The program-controlled unit is distinguished by the fact that the debug resources are able also to influence other components of the program-controlled unit and/or the cooperation of these components with one another and/or with the core. Such action makes it possible to avoid to the greatest possible extent, in a simple manner, the situation wherein disturbances or errors that do not occur in normal operation of the program-controlled unit occur during the debugging or emulation of the program-controlled unit, and/or wherein errors that occur in normal operation of the program-controlled unit do not occur during the debugging or emulation of the program-controlled unit.
    Type: Grant
    Filed: August 8, 2002
    Date of Patent: May 22, 2007
    Assignee: Infineon Technologies AG
    Inventor: Klaus D. Maier
  • Publication number: 20040193853
    Abstract: A program-controlled unit (e.g., a microprocessor) including one or more cores and one or more peripheral component circuits connected to buses (conductive lines), and also including debug resources coupled to the buses for monitoring the transmission of trace information (e.g., selected addresses, data and/or control signals), for generating corresponding signals (e.g., the actual trace information or associated identification codes) that are output from the program-controlled unit or stored in it.
    Type: Application
    Filed: April 23, 2004
    Publication date: September 30, 2004
    Inventors: Klaus D. Maier, Dietmar Konig, Andreas Kolof, Albrecht Mayer
  • Publication number: 20030061544
    Abstract: A program-controlled unit includes a core for executing the program to be executed by the program-controlled unit, and debug resources for tracking and influencing the operations proceeding within the core. The program-controlled unit is distinguished by the fact that the debug resources are able also to influence other components of the program-controlled unit and/or the cooperation of these components with one another and/or with the core. Such action makes it possible to avoid to the greatest possible extent, in a simple manner, the situation wherein disturbances or errors that do not occur in normal operation of the program-controlled unit occur during the debugging or emulation of the program-controlled unit, and/or wherein errors that occur in normal operation of the program-controlled unit do not occur during the debugging or emulation of the program-controlled unit.
    Type: Application
    Filed: August 8, 2002
    Publication date: March 27, 2003
    Inventor: Klaus D. Maier